AceShowbiz - Drake apparently does not want Kendrick Lamar to belt out "Not Like Us" at the upcoming Super Bowl. The "Hotline Bling" hitmaker allegedly has been trying to stop his nemesis from performing the successful diss track against him.
Revealing the news was Wack 100, who discussed the matter with a group of people. Wack 100, whose real name is Cash Jones, claimed that the 37-year-old Canadian hip-hop artist served Kendrick a cease and desist "so that he can't perform" the song at the 2025 Apple Music Super Bowl LIX Halftime Show.
The music manager/record executive then received a question about what would happen if Kendrick, who is also famous as K.Dot, decided to deliver the song despite the cease and desist. In response, he stated, "He's tryna get the NFL to restrict Kendrick."

The revelation came after it was announced that K.Dot will perform on February 9, 2025 at the iconic Caesars Superdome in New Orleans. The rapper, who co-founded pgLang with Dave Free, will work with the creative company to direct his Super Bowl performance. He shared, "Rap music is still the most impactful genre to date. And I'll be there to remind the world why. They got the right one."
Kendrick, who dropped "Not Like Us" on May 4, performed the Drake diss track live for the first time at his epic "Pop Out: Ken & Friends" concert. At the show, which was held at the Kia Forum in Inglewood, California, on June 19, he delivered the song five times, leaving the packed audience excited.
